Property-focused tips for planning around Rocky Mesa Place and West Hills

When you evaluate a home near Rocky Mesa Place, start with the basics that affect underwriting and ownership costs. Confirm the property type and zoning early. Single-family homes usually finance smoothly, but additions and conversions can raise questions. Ask for permit history if you see a garage conversion or expanded living area. In hillside-adjacent parts of West Hills, insurance can be a major variable. Get an early homeowners insurance quote, and ask about wildfire-related underwriting rules. If the home is in a higher fire severity zone, you may need extra time for coverage. That can impact closing speed, so start early. Review roof age, electrical panels, and plumbing materials. Those items can affect insurability and appraisal notes. Also check for HOA rules if the home is in a planned community. HOA dues change your debt-to-income ratio and approval amount. If you are considering 9242 ROCKY MESA PL WEST HILLS CA 91304 as a reference point, compare recent sales within a tight radius. Appraisers often prioritize proximity and similar lot characteristics. West Hills buyers also care about school boundaries and commute patterns. Those preferences can influence resale value and rental demand. How to shorten closing time without sacrificing quality

Fast closings come from preparation, not pressure. Start by gathering two months of bank statements and recent pay documentation. If you are self-employed, prepare two years of returns and a year-to-date profit and loss statement. Keep large deposits documented, because underwriters will ask. Avoid opening new credit lines during escrow. Even a small monthly payment can change approval terms. If you are an investor, line up lease comps and reserve funds early. If you are a foreign buyer, confirm acceptable asset sourcing and transfer timing. For VA buyers, confirm your COE and discuss any property condition concerns.
